Come installare e disinstallare un'estensione

Area dedicata alle guide di phpBB 3
Rispondi
Avatar utente
alex75
Amministratore
Amministratore
Messaggi: 6125
Iscritto il: 23/08/2012, 23:45
Link del Forum: www.phpbb-italia.it
Località: Palermo

Come installare e disinstallare un'estensione

Messaggio da alex75 »

Installare un'estensione è semplicissimo, basta fare un pò di attenzione nel copiarla nella corretta directory.
Scaricate l'estensione da installare e decomprimetela.
Copiate la cartella decompressa sulla root del vostro forum, sotto la cartella "EXT".
percorso ext.png
La cartella copiata avrà sempre la sequenza "nome autore/nome estensione" ad esempio "alex75/myicons" in caso contrario provvedete a rinominare queste 2 cartelle correttamente, altrimenti l'estensione non sarà visibile sul pca. Spesso capita infatti di scaricare estensioni la cui cartella principale viene rinominata in "phpbb-italia-alex75-Master". In caso di dubbi, per avere la certezza di quale sia il giusto nome, potete aprire con notepad++ il file composer.json (che troverete all'interno di tutte le estensioni) e leggere il corretto percorso dell'estensione.
alla riga "name" vedrete il corretto percorso (nell'esempio in foto: alex75/myicons).
percorso ext in composer json.png
A questo punto, andiamo sul pca/personalizzazioni/gestione estensioni ed abilitiamo l'estensione dall'elenco.
Svuotate la cache dal pca.
L'estensione è ora installata, ma per qualcuna potrebbero servire ulteriori settaggi (allo scopo della stessa estensione) che troverete sul pca/estensioni.

Per disinstallare un'estensione:
Disabilitare l'estensione dal pca/personalizzazioni/gestione estensioni
Successivamente cliccare su "cancella i dati" nella lista delle estensioni disabilitate
ext cancella i dati.png
Svuotate la cache dal PCA
E solo adesso si potranno cancellare i file da ftp.

EDIT 11/03/2023:
Cosa fare in caso di eventuali file di traduzione italiana mancanti: post25357.html#p25357
Non hai i permessi necessari per visualizzare i file allegati in questo messaggio.
Regolamento Forum
Le nostre guide
Se l'assistenza prestata è stata di tuo gradimento potrai contribuire aiutandoci a sostenere le spese affrontate per tenere in vita questo forum >Cliccando sul seguente Link<
Avatar utente
ilpino
Trusted
Trusted
Messaggi: 87
Iscritto il: 06/03/2013, 18:16
Link del Forum: www.mitichegs.it
Località: venezia

Re: Come installare e disinstallare un'estensione

Messaggio da ilpino »

ciao Alex, come funziona se ci fosse un'aggiornamento? si sostituisce la cartella e via o bisogna disinstallare e installare di nuovo? e le preferenze restano? mi vengono in mente per esempio board3 portal o lightbox, dove per quest'ultima hai già messo un aggiornamento
Avatar utente
alex75
Amministratore
Amministratore
Messaggi: 6125
Iscritto il: 23/08/2012, 23:45
Link del Forum: www.phpbb-italia.it
Località: Palermo

Re: Come installare e disinstallare un'estensione

Messaggio da alex75 »

assolutamente no. La procedura corretta è sempre quella di disinstallare, cancellare i vecchi file e reinstallare i nuovi.
Solo dietro consiglio dello sviluppatore si possono adottare altri sistemi, come ad esempio sostituire un unico file modificato (questo nel caso non vengano aggiunti o rimossi file) o disinstallare senza cancellare i dati ( quest'ultima pericolosa e raramente funzionante, specialmente se si eliminano/aggiungono file). Ad ogni modo per ogni estensione e per ogni tipo di aggiornamento può valere una o l'altra ipotesi.
Di certo come ho detto all'inizio, l'unico metodo corretto e sicuro, è quello di disinstallare, cancellare i dati, rimuovere i file e caricare ed installare i nuovi.
Regolamento Forum
Le nostre guide
Se l'assistenza prestata è stata di tuo gradimento potrai contribuire aiutandoci a sostenere le spese affrontate per tenere in vita questo forum >Cliccando sul seguente Link<
Avatar utente
ilpino
Trusted
Trusted
Messaggi: 87
Iscritto il: 06/03/2013, 18:16
Link del Forum: www.mitichegs.it
Località: venezia

Re: Come installare e disinstallare un'estensione

Messaggio da ilpino »

:thumbup:
Avatar utente
Alex
Registered User
Registered User
Messaggi: 5
Iscritto il: 22/09/2016, 15:32
Link del Forum: no

Re: Come installare e disinstallare un'estensione

Messaggio da Alex »

Grazie mille della guida!
Avatar utente
roybell
Registered User
Registered User
Messaggi: 26
Iscritto il: 14/01/2017, 11:06
Link del Forum: Campo non specificato

Re: Come installare e disinstallare un'estensione

Messaggio da roybell »

Ottimo, grazie mille!
Andrea Isi
Trusted
Trusted
Messaggi: 151
Iscritto il: 16/01/2017, 3:50
Link del Forum: No

Re: Come installare e disinstallare un'estensione

Messaggio da Andrea Isi »

alex75 ha scritto:Installare un'estensione è semplicissimo, basta fare un pò di attenzione nel copiarla nella corretta directory.
Scaricate l'estensione da installare e decomprimetela.
Copiate la cartella decompressa sulla root del vostro forum, sotto la cartella "EXT".
percorso.jpg
La cartella copiata avrà sempre la sequenza "nome autore/nome estensione" ad esempio "alex75/myicons" in caso contrario provvedete a rinominare queste 2 cartelle correttamente, altrimenti l'estensione non sarà visibile sul pca. Spesso capita infatti di scaricare estensioni la cui cartella principale viene rinominata in "phpbb-store-alex75-Master". In caso di dubbi, per avere la certezza di quale sia il giusto nome, potete aprire con notepad++ il file composer.json (che troverete all'interno di tutte le estensioni) e leggere il corretto percorso dell'estensione.
alla riga "name" vedrete il corretto percorso (nell'esempio in foto: alex75/myicons).
composer.jpg
A questo punto, andiamo sul pca/personalizzazioni/gestione estensioni ed abilitiamo l'estensione dall'elenco.
Svuotate la cache dal pca.
L'estensione è ora installata, ma per qualcuna potrebbero servire ulteriori settaggi (allo scopo della stessa estensione) che troverete sul pca/estensioni.

Per disinstallare un'estensione:
Disabilitare l'estensione dal pca/personalizzazioni/gestione estensioni
Successivamente cancellare i dati dalla lista delle estensioni disabilitate
cancella dati.png
Svuotate la cache dal PCA
E solo adesso si potranno cancellare i file da ftp.
Io sono andato nella pagina delle estensioni, ho premuto il tasto cancella dati a destra dell'estensione, ma ora cosa devo fare?
Devo cancellare la cartella tramite FTP e poi svuotare la cache?
Avatar utente
alex75
Amministratore
Amministratore
Messaggi: 6125
Iscritto il: 23/08/2012, 23:45
Link del Forum: www.phpbb-italia.it
Località: Palermo

Re: Come installare e disinstallare un'estensione

Messaggio da alex75 »

Si esatto. Adesso puoi cancellare la cartella dell'estensione.
Regolamento Forum
Le nostre guide
Se l'assistenza prestata è stata di tuo gradimento potrai contribuire aiutandoci a sostenere le spese affrontate per tenere in vita questo forum >Cliccando sul seguente Link<
Andrea Isi
Trusted
Trusted
Messaggi: 151
Iscritto il: 16/01/2017, 3:50
Link del Forum: No

Re: Come installare e disinstallare un'estensione

Messaggio da Andrea Isi »

Perfetto grazie :D
Avatar utente
alex75
Amministratore
Amministratore
Messaggi: 6125
Iscritto il: 23/08/2012, 23:45
Link del Forum: www.phpbb-italia.it
Località: Palermo

Re: Come installare e disinstallare un'estensione

Messaggio da alex75 »

:hi:
Regolamento Forum
Le nostre guide
Se l'assistenza prestata è stata di tuo gradimento potrai contribuire aiutandoci a sostenere le spese affrontate per tenere in vita questo forum >Cliccando sul seguente Link<
Rispondi